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about acura repair services in Moravia, NY

What are the most common Acura repair issues for drivers in the Moravia, NY area?

Given our rural roads and harsh winter climate, common issues include premature wear on suspension components like struts and control arms from potholes, as well as brake system problems due to road salt corrosion. Many local Acura owners also report issues with variable valve timing (VVT) systems, which are sensitive and require precise diagnosis.

How can I find a trustworthy and specialized Acura repair shop near Moravia?

Look for shops in the Finger Lakes region that are members of the Automotive Service Association (ASA) or have ASE-certified technicians, specifically with experience in Honda/Acura models. It's also wise to check reviews for shops in nearby Auburn or Cortland that mention expertise with Acura's SH-AWD system, which is complex and requires specialized knowledge.

Are repair costs for Acuras higher in Moravia compared to dealerships in larger cities like Syracuse?

Labor rates at independent shops in the Moravia area are typically lower than at dealerships in Syracuse or Ithaca, potentially saving you money on major services. However, for certain proprietary parts or complex computer diagnostics, you may still need to source from a dealer, so a local shop with a direct dealer parts account is advantageous.

When should I seek local service for my Acura's warning lights instead of driving to a distant dealer?

Seek immediate local diagnosis for critical warnings like the check engine light, brake system light, or oil pressure light, especially before driving on long, hilly routes common in Cayuga County. A qualified local technician can perform initial diagnostics to determine if it's safe to drive to a specialist or if the repair can be completed locally.

What local factors in Moravia should influence my Acura's maintenance schedule?

The significant seasonal temperature swings and heavy road salt use demand more frequent undercarriage washes to prevent rust and more vigilant attention to your battery and cooling system. Given the long distances between services in our area, adhering strictly to the manufacturer's severe service schedule for fluid changes is highly recommended.
